## Further reading

Giftpost is the donation-receipt mailer for the Alderview platform. Key docs for review: threat model (covers receipt tampering and enumeration), PII retention policy (receipts purge at 7 years), and the template-injection audit from last cycle. Signing keys rotate quarterly; rotation procedure is documented separately. All of the above, plus prior review findings, are indexed on a single internal page.

runbook for tajep-yahig: https://artifactory.lumictech.corp/repo

**Minutes — Pricing Sync, Tuesday AM**

Quick one today. Marta walked us through the plan to move legacy Corvalta customers onto the new tiered rates from Q3. Sales leads should start soft-flagging this in renewal calls — no hard numbers yet. Dev from the Kelbrook office raised churn worries; we'll cap increases at 12% for accounts older than five years. Full talking points next week. The confidential outline of where this fits in the broader plan follows below.

management briefing: Silethax Systems plans to raise the Holix list price by 50.2 percent in December. The steering committee signed off on a budget of $329.9 million for Project Holok. The renewal with Juldorax Foods closes at $278.2 million a year, 54.3 percent above the last contract. Project Briir slips by one quarter because of the supplier delay.

### Item 12 — Job queue replacement (Harvest Loop)

Confirm the retirement of the homegrown Harvest Loop job queue and its replacement's access controls: queue credentials rotated, the legacy polling daemon disabled, and dead-letter contents reviewed for residual sensitive payloads. Document any exceptions with dates and compensating controls. Accountability for this migration rests with the individual named below.

approver of bagug-bagag = Holael Pramir